Tinder Users to Soon 'Swipe Right' for More Than Just Dates
Credit: Mashable composite. Tinder

Tinder users will soon be able to pay for extra features that may not be related to dating.

The company is slated to roll out an update in November that adds extra paid features, CEO Sean Rad said in an interview with Forbes.

Rad did not elaborate on what the app's upcoming changes would be, but he said the current service, which matches users based on who's nearby, would not change.

“Our core offering that you have right now is always going to remain free,” Rad said. “Next month we’re going to release a few premium features that we’re totally excited about. It’s two things that our users have been asking for for a very long time and we think there’s a great opportunity for us to introduce these features and because we’re confident the value is there…we’re going to charge for it.”

Though the CEO didn't go into detail about the changes, he hinted the company was looking to take advantage of the ways Tinder users "hack" the service for purposes other than dating. Users may take to Tinder to promote their Instagram accounts, get local recommendations when visiting a new city or even find potential business partners, for example.

“We hear all these cases where people [are] using Tinder outside of dating," Rad said. "There’s all these various hacks and it’s great. We’re now learning from our users and those hacks to find the next opportunities.”

Though Tinder is known for its gesture-based matchmaking system, the company has experimented with other features related to dating in the past. Last summer, the app was updated with a matchmaker feature, that allowed users to introduce mutual Facebook friends via Tinder. And Rad revealed plans to roll out a verification system for the app's celeb users earlier this year.
